NYC Real Estate Expo coming soon

The first annual NYC Real Estate Expo will be held at The Roosevelt Hotel in Manhattan, from 9 a.m. to 6 p.m. on Friday, October 30.

Expo executive director Anthony Kazazis explained that, for the past two years, a real estate expo was held in Queens. He said that holding it stemmed from his love of expos and networking.

Kazazis, who also does title insurance work, said that he realized if the expo was held “in the city” many more people would attend. This year, he expects the number of attendees to be triple the number that attended the expo in Queens.

Experts such as bankers, attorneys, real estate brokers, developers, mortgage companies, title insurance companies, accounts and financial planners will have exhibits during the expo. There will be more than 100 exhibitors participating.

“We have a lot to offer,” Kazazis said.

There will also be free educational seminars. Speakers include Steven Spinola of REBNY; Tom Anderson of Pensco Trust Company; Robert Knakal of Massey Knakal Realty Services; Jorge J. Lopez of Con Edison Solutions; the staff of StreetEasy; John Kazazis of ARS Abstract Ltd.; Raymond Villani of Bid on the City; Ryan Slack of Greenpearl.com; Marilyn S. Kane of Sperry Van Ness-Butler Kane Commercial Real Estate; Steve Acevedo III of HSBC Mortgage Corporation USA; Fred Swint of Wells Fargo SBA Lending; Todd R. Pajonas, Esq. of Legal 1031 Exchange Services Inc.; Edward E. Neiger, Esq. of Neiger LLP; Michael J. Romer, Esq. of Becker & Poliakoff LLP; Neil R. Weinstein, Esq. of Ingram Yuzek Gainen Carroll & Bertolotti LLP, and George Eliopoulos of MW Commercial Capital Corp.

Some of the topics that will be discussed will be “Today’s Economic Crisis and New York’s Future,” “How Current Economic Conditions are Impacting the Investment Sales Market,” and “The New Way to Buy and Sell Real Estate.”

During the expo, Kazazis said that attendees will be able to meet representatives of new companies that offer interesting products. He also said that education is an important component of the expo.

“People basically just want to go there and learn and find out what’s happening,” he said.

Next year, Kazazis said that he plans to expand the expo to a two-day event, with one day dedicated to residential real estate and the other to commercial real estate.
